The reported issue of Rescinded program blocks not having a high-dated Pending status after the use of Application Opened in Error has been fixed. However, staff should still refrain from using this Negative Action reason. If an application is registered in error, a ticket should be submitted to the KEES Help Desk for it to be addressed by Help Desk Staff.
The issue where the Rescind Detail page was only presenting one group of Program Persons at a time rather than presenting all appropriate persons at the same time, has now been fixed.
While the two major issues with the Rescind function have now been fixed, staff should note that some cases that were impacted by these defects may still need a data fix before they will be ready to be worked. If a ticket has been submitted to the KEES Help Desk for a registration related issue, please know that we are working through these cases as fast as we can. Please refrain from applying any unapproved workarounds to these cases.
